Cutoff Trends for B.Tech in Computer Engineering:

  • 2024: 99.85
  • 2023: The closing percentile for the General Home State category was 99.9.

  • 2022: The closing percentile was 99.82.

  • 2021: The closing percentile was 99.9.

Alumni of SIES College of Management Studies have made careers in all fields, many in leading organizations such as Amazon, Google, Deloitte, KPMG, and Accenture, taking management, consulting, finance, marketing, and operations roles. Others started entrepreneurship ventures and own their businesses, and a few are in large multinational companies as leaders. The college's wide network and strong placement support system ensure graduates find opportunities in top-tier firms both in India and globally, which are the reasons behind SIESCOMS' reputation of producing skilled and highly employable professionals.

The application process to the SIES College of Management Studies, or SIESCOMS, is multiple-stepped. First, a candidate has to get himself registered and fill the application form online on the college's official website. On submission of the application form, applicants have to upload all the required documents as well as pay the prescribed application fee. Following that, candidates have to undergo an entrance exam that is CAT, XAT, MAT, CMAT, ATMA, or MAH CET. Cut offs for SIES College of Management Studies (SIESCOMS) depend on the cut off marks for entrance exam. For MBA/PGDM, the general cut-off for CAT is around a 50 percentile. Similarly for other exams like MAT, CMAT, and ATMA one should secure above 85 percentile only for consideration. The final shortlisting also considers the academic history and work experience with performance in Group Discussions and Personal Interviews.
